Outline of Final Research Achievements |
Application of electromagnetic induction methods, which were well-known for induction heating and microwave, to lead removal from CRT glass was proposed in order to render that harmless and recycle that. Carbon material can be used to not only reductant but also heat source because that has conducting properties. Therefore, it is possible to melt the CRT glass, reduce lead oxide in that and separate lead from that using electromagnetic induction methods. From the results of experiments, it was indicated that almost half of lead was removed from the CRT glass by microwave heating in several minutes.
